A. Mitchell Palmer, President Wilson’s Attorney-General tried to take political advantage of what was called “The Red Scare” beginning in 1919. There was a feeling in the United States that communists were trying to infiltrate government and state and local organizations, like labor unions. Palmer ordered a series of raids on various suspected communist headquarters. Hundreds of immigrants and suspected communists were rounded up for deportation. It was discovered that only 39 of the suspects could actually be deported under US law, as the others were doing nothing illegal. Regardless, the Attorney-General deported over 200 suspected communists to Russia on a steamship called “the Soviet Ark.” On New Years Day, 1920, 6,000 people were arrested in Palmer Raids. Some were simply bystanders, but almost all served some time in jail.
